Output 40251266aa1689076395bb73a134e1d6d4736108dec9ce9e4374f1aef93b0a0d:1

value
569228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9de4c7230d186d3e187e3bd5392a2258e4d4a3b OP_EQUAL
address
3MYzrkS9dHcvhzjezhZbFqumjnYHBc7qPX
transaction
40251266aa1689076395bb73a134e1d6d4736108dec9ce9e4374f1aef93b0a0d
spent
true